I expected to see variation in sizes because of height, and muscle too will make a big difference, I really DIDN'T expect someone 4 inches shorter to expect to be two dress sizes less!

It would be interesting to see what the variance was if we all had the same sets of clothes for fit and scale. I suspect it would be a lot narrower range, vanity sizing has gone a bit mad. I have a size 16 dress from years ago (early 90s vintage!) as my 'goal dress', I cannot fit into it until I weigh circa 11stone (I'm 5'8" and generally fit in modern 12s then).
